
Iowa Wolves Add Pedro Bradshaw
Published on January 18, 2022 under NBA G League (G League)
Iowa Wolves News Release
The Iowa Wolves, the G League affiliate of the Minnesota Timberwolves, today announced the team has added guard Pedro Bradshaw from the available player pool. Bradshaw will be available for Iowa's game tonight at Agua Caliente.
He joins the Wolves after playing four G League regular season games with Sioux Falls where he averaged 4.8 points and 1.5 rebounds per game. During the G League's Showcase Cup, he played three games with the Skyforce and four games with Salt Lake City, averaging 7.3 points and 2.7 rebounds per game.
Bradshaw is in his first professional season after a standout collegiate career where he played his final two seasons for Bellarmine University.
Iowa returns to Wells Fargo Arena on Jan. 23 to play the Texas Legends at 4 p.m. CT.
